Tampa Catholic High School Junior, Armando Mayo (older brother of Malio, grade 5), graduated from ICS in 2011. Armando serves as a Florida delegate to the National Youth Leadership Mission, which is associated with the Anti-Defamation League. Recently, Armando and a group of nine other high school students from the Tampa Bay area were selected to travel to Washington D.C. in November of this year to address the Mission's Executive Board. HALL OF HONORS

Our 2nd class of inductees into the Incarnation Catholic School Hall of Honors will take place on Friday May 2. If you would like to nominate someone for induction, please contact the Main Office for a nomination form.

ICS Hall of Honors Class of 2013: (left to right) Sr. Eugene Marie, Sr. Emmeline, Coach Slowey and Sr. Michael Patrick. 
Criteria for the Hall of Honors are included here:

Incarnation Catholic School graduates go on to successful high school, college and professional careers. And wherever they work, in whatever discipline they are in, you can find them at the top. This is due in part to the strong academic and spiritual foundation laid at ICS, at the outstanding homes of ICS families and as a result of the exemplar moral character of individual ICS students, faculty, staff, priests and volunteers. 
The Incarnation Catholic School Hall of Honors recognizes alumni, faculty and staff, parents, priests, benefactors and friends of the school who made significant contributions to the School, Church, and / or world at large.
Candidates for the Incarnation Catholic School Hall of Honors must be nominated by someone other than the nominee him/herself. The School Advisory Board of Incarnation Catholic School, in consultation with the Pastor and Principal, review nominations and select qualified candidates for the year's class of inductees.
Nominations are due by March 15, 2014.
